City leaders in Warsaw say two new taxes will result in better streets.
The city council voted, this week, to establish a pair of utility taxes.
One of the taxes would be on the electricity delivered by Ameren Illinois.
The ordinance establishes a sliding scale for residential or business use within the city.
The other tax would be on natural gas and its delivery from Nicor.
Instead of a sliding scale, residents and businesses would be charged a 5% tax.
